How to calculate self weight of column. Calculation :- height of column = 3 m. Assume Size of column = 9″×9″ Inch into mm = 230mm× 230mm. For calculating self load for column we have require self weight of concrete that is 2500 kg/m3 for RCC and self weight of Steel that is approx. …

Web30 okt. 2008 · Since Revit is using units of in-wg/100 ft for the density of steel it is necessary to convert 490 pcf to these units. Because 1 in-wg = 5.202 psf, the conversion factor to convert pcf to in-wg/100ft is (490 pcf/5.202 psf)*100ft = 9420.
